Post by Roareye »

I'm compiling a list of preferred regions its best to have each game from. Some games have exclusive features in some reasons and not in others.
A good example is Buggy Heat, the Japanese version has Online features and competitive AI play not seen in the PAL version (which in itself has more modes than the US TNN Motorheat)
Another example is Resident Evil: Code Veronica which is the same across PAL and USA except the PAL version does not support VGA for some reason. In that case you'd want the USA version because it's also in English (unlike the Japanese version)

I'll also try to add in if there are translated versions of Japanese games.
